Most new portable routers advertise the same headline features: 4G LTE or 5G modem, support for multiple simultaneous users, an internal battery, and modern Wi‑Fi standards (Wi‑Fi 5 or Wi‑Fi 6). Some models now include eSIM support so you can switch carriers remotely, while others offer a physical SIM slot and external antenna ports to boost reception. Manufacturers also highlight compact designs and multi‑day battery life.

In practical terms, a portable router's value comes down to coverage, sustained speed, and stability. In Lagos, Abuja and other major cities, 4G is widely available and speeds should satisfy common tasks: streaming, video calls and cloud apps. In more rural areas where only 2G/3G or weak 4G exist, even the best router can't create coverage out of thin air. A router with external antenna support can help in fringe areas.
Real‑world throughput also hinges on the device's modem and carrier aggregation support. High‑end MiFis that aggregate multiple bands perform better in congested networks, but these models are pricier. Many viral clips focus on headline speeds in ideal conditions — often not representative of busy Nigerian networks during peak hours.
If you plan to host multiple users, Wi‑Fi capacity matters. Cheaper routers may slow significantly with five or more simultaneous high‑bandwidth users. Conversely, for solo professionals or small families, a mid‑range model usually suffices.
A major advantage over smartphone tethering is battery separation: a dedicated hotspot preserves your phone’s battery for calls and apps. Most portable routers weigh 120–300 grams and fit in a bag pocket, making them genuinely portable. Battery life claims vary — manufacturers often cite standby times rather than continuous real‑world streaming — so expect shorter durations under load.
Durability and design matter in regions with unreliable power and outdoor use. Look for models with robust housings, external antenna ports and an easy-to-read battery indicator. Some routers double as power banks, letting you charge a phone in an outage — useful in parts of Nigeria where grid reliability remains a challenge.
Note: exact battery runtime varies with signal strength, number of active clients and whether 5G is used. Where possible, test or read independent local reviews to confirm manufacturer claims.
Portable routers are small networking devices but still require proper configuration. Many ship with default passwords that should be changed immediately. Look for WPA3 support for stronger Wi‑Fi encryption; if the device only supports WPA2, it remains usable but slightly less future‑proof. Firmware updates are important — a device left unpatched can be vulnerable, so choose a brand that provides timely updates.
Privacy is another consideration. Using a mobile carrier ties you to their logging policies and local data rules. Some travellers use a VPN on the router or on individual devices to encrypt traffic and hide metadata. If unsure about a model's security features or update policy, reach out to the manufacturer or consult recent reviews.
Price is a key factor. A new 5G portable router can cost significantly more than a mid‑range smartphone or a basic 4G MiFi. In Nigeria, initial device cost is only part of the story — data bundle prices, network promotions and SIM compatibility shape the total cost of ownership. Mobile data remains comparatively expensive in many African countries, though prices have generally trended downwards in recent years.
Alternatives to a dedicated router include smartphone tethering, fixed wireless access (FWA) from local ISPs, and community broadband initiatives. Tethering is convenient and usually free but drains your phone battery and may limit the number of connected devices. FWA can deliver better performance for a home or small office but requires installation and may not be portable. For travellers and small teams who need portable, multi‑user connectivity, a MiFi often scales better than tethering.
Before buying, compare total monthly costs: prepaid data plans, potential roaming charges if you travel, and the router’s resale value. If the viral review focuses only on speed tests without addressing local data economics, treat it as only part of the picture.
A portable Wi‑Fi router is a good fit if you need consistent multi‑device connectivity on the move, have frequent meetings or work locations without reliable fixed broadband, or travel between areas with varying signal strength and want the ability to add an external antenna. Small teams, field workers, journalists and frequent travellers across Nigeria and neighbouring countries often benefit the most.
If you primarily use the internet on a single phone and have access to a decent home broadband plan, the extra expense may not be justified. Likewise, if you rely on unlimited high‑speed data at home through a fixed connection, a dedicated MiFi offers limited added value.
